Two First Nations artists based in Quambone are set to hit the Australian Museum in February and May where they have sold out their Winhangadurinya: Aboriginal Meditation workshops.
With all 17 tickets sold for each of the eight dates, Milan Dhiiyaan artists Fleur and Laurance (Locky) Magick Dennis are grateful to get to share their culture with so many participants.
Mrs Magick Dennis said the meditation, taking participants through Indigenous spirituality and culture, was inspired by her uncle, Brewarrina local Professor Jack Beetson.
